American Legion
The American Legion, established by an Act of Congress after World War I, is the nation's largest veteran service organization dedicated to advocating for the needs of veterans, service members, and their families. With a history spanning over a century, the organization focuses on mental health support, community engagement, and empowering individuals to take action in preventing veteran suicide.
Through various programs such as American Legion Baseball and youth development initiatives, the American Legion promotes values like leadership and sportsmanship while providing vital resources and support to local communities.
